Early Times Report Jammu, Mar 8: A blood donation camp was organized at Model Institute of Engineering and Technology, Kot Bhalwal, Jammu for Thalassemic children by Thalassemia Society of MIET (TSOM) in collaboration with "J&K Thalassemia Welfare Society" along with "J&K YOUNG Thalassemia Alliance". Students and staff of the college donated blood voluntarily. Over 120 students registered for blood donation, out of which, around 102 candidates physically donated blood.
